1. Combine 1 ounce of light rum, 1 ounce of dark rum, half an ounce of Orgeat syrup and ½ ounce of orange liqueur in a cocktail shaker with plenty of ice. 2. Shake well until the drink is chilled, then strain over crushed ice. 3. Add 2 – 3 ounces of pineapple juice and adjust the amount of juice to taste. Just a short walk along Kalakaua Avenue, the famous Royal Hawaiian Hotel is known as the ‘Pink Palace of the Pacific.’ It opened in 1927, capturing 15 acres of beautiful beach frontage.Trader Vic took his Oakland-created Mai Tai to Hawaii in 1953 while creating drinks for the Royal Hawaiian Hotel. As his supply of 17 and 15-year old J. Wray Nephew Jamaican rum was dwindling, he altered his recipe to substitute 1 ounce of a cheaper Jamaican rum. This recipe reflects that change.
